A Written Diary by Muhammad Jadallah on the Visit of Anwar al-Sadat, 1977

Handwritten in Arabic by Muhammad Jadallah, this document shows his diary; where he wrote about the visit of Anwar al-Sadat to al-Aqsa Mosque on 20 November 1977. Jadallah was standing among the first raw at the Sanctum of Saladin al-Ayubi, while al-Sadat came along with Egyptian Armed Forces and Israeli Occupation Forces, and "Abu Nihad" spoke about al-Sadat crying after praying at al-Aqsa Mosque following his arrival.
